Tegean Capital Management's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2019, Tegean Capital Management held 23 positions worth $114M, down 23% from $147M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 81% of the portfolio.
Tegean Capital Management withdrew a net $39.3M in Q2 2019, closing 6 positions and reducing 10 holdings. Its most notable exit was KeyCorp, an estimated $7.09M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 58% of assets, down from 61%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.
Against the trend, Tegean Capital Management opened a new position in Ares Capital worth $4.49M.
